I did win a dinner for 6 at the Chinese Buffet Restaurant.......NOT!! I had filled out a ballot to win a Kitchen Aid mixer and they called to tell me I won the dinner for 6 instead. I thought nothing was odd until I talked to some other people on the street who had also won. When they got to the restaurant they had to sit through a 1 hour presentation about fire safety equipment. then they were given their whole meal and then they showed up at the park to sell them stuff and would not leave for 2 1/2 hours. Thank goodness I never got as far as to make the reservation for Colin and I and our friends. We did send a nasty email to the head office of the Restaurant to tell them what we thought of the whole deal. for anyone in Texas who reads this the Restaurant in question is Linn's Chinese Buffet.........Don't fill in the ballot as surely you will win!
